Bearcats Announce New Social Seats Promotion
Bearcats Announce New Social Seats Promotion

Feb. 7, 2012

CINCINNATI - The University of Cincinnati Department of Athletics has announced a new men's basketball ticket and social media promotion, the Social Seats.

Social Seats is an exclusive offer to fans of the UC Facebook page and followers of the GoBEARCATS twitter account. Fans who purchase tickets for any of the remaining four men's basketball games (and those who have already purchased tickets for those games) will be entered into a random drawing. The winner will receive two upgraded lower-level seats for the game they are attending and two media credentials with access to the media room, media hospitality area, and postgame press conferences. Winners will be encouraged to document their experience on their respective social networks and will receive recognition on the Fifth Third Arena video board.

Here's how to get involved.
1. Log in to Facebook and Twitter to follow UC's updates.
2. Find the special promotion code which will only be announced on the social platforms.
3. Log on to CATSTIX.com to purchase your tickets for the remaining home contests using the promo code.
4. Check UC's Facebook and Twitter feeds to see if you are the big winner.
5. Enjoy the game!
